There is no specific device that allows you to connect a Game Boy to a Nintendo 64. The closest to this is the Transfer Pak, which allows you to use Pokemon from Game Boy Pokemon games on Pokemon Stadium and Pokemon Stadium 2, and transfer characters from the Game Boy Mario Tennis game to the Nintendo 64 version.

Nintendo DS Lite systems can communicate with DS and DSi systems in PictoChat and DS games. DS Lites cannot connect with Game Boy Advance systems while playing Game Boy Advance games, however.
